The owners of Angelo’s II in Monongahela have truly outdone themselves.

You probably remember Santa peering — a bit mischievously —  from the restaurant’s rooftop last Christmas, overlooking a 17-foot lit Christmas tree.

This spring, a towering Easter Bunny held court over Mon City.

As Halloween draws near, the Stay Puft Marshmallow Man has taken up residence atop Angelo’s II and he now looms over Monongahela.

“Ghostbusters” movie fans know that Ray Stantz accidentally chose the Stay Puft Marshmallow Man as “the form of the destructor,” but the mind behind the massive green-tentacled monster reaching from the Main Street restaurant belongs to Peter Dzimiera. 

The hulking beast in the midst of town has created a buzz that you might say is about the size of a Twinkie, if it were 35 feet long and weighed about 600 pounds.
